Brain nursing bracket
By designing a liftable brain care bracket, the problem that the existing device cannot adapt to the height of the bed and adjust the position of the pillow is solved, thereby improving patient comfort and cleaning efficiency.

AI Technical Summary
Existing nursing devices cannot adapt to different bed heights and cannot adjust the position of the pillow, causing discomfort or even secondary injuries to patients.
A brain care bracket was designed, which adopts a lifting device and a screw mechanism, combined with an electric push rod and a water pipe system to achieve height adjustment and flexible adjustment of the pillow position. It is equipped with a soft pillow and a nozzle to improve comfort and cleaning efficiency.
The nursing bracket can be matched with the height of the bed, the position of the pillow can be adjusted to improve patient comfort, and the cleaning efficiency and work efficiency can be improved through simple operation to reduce the risk of infection.

Technical Field
[0001] The utility model relates to a bracket, in particular to a brain care bracket. Background Art
[0002] Brain surgery generally refers to neurosurgery, which is a discipline that utilizes neurosurgery and mainly uses examination, surgery as a path, comprehensive treatment, and comprehensive evaluation. Patients who have undergone brain surgery should receive periodic care during the recovery period.
[0003] However, existing nursing devices cannot adapt well to the heights of different hospital beds, resulting in a certain height difference between the hospital bed and the nursing device during actual use. In addition, the position of the pillow cannot be adjusted for patients with different neck lengths, which makes the patients uncomfortable and even causes secondary injuries to the patients.
[0004] Therefore, it is necessary to design a brain care bracket that can adapt to different bed heights and can adjust the occipital position for different patients. Utility Model Content
[0005] In order to overcome the shortcomings of existing nursing devices that cannot adjust the height and occipital position, thereby causing discomfort to patients, the purpose of the utility model is to provide a brain nursing bracket.
[0006] The utility model provides a brain care bracket, which includes a base, a sliding block, a connecting frame, a guide plate, wheels, a screw rod, a turntable, a water pipe and a connecting block. The base is provided with four wheels, a lifting device is provided in the middle of the top of the base, a connecting frame is provided on the top of the lifting device, a left-right symmetrical guide plate is provided in the middle of the connecting frame, a screw rod is rotatably provided on the left guide plate, a turntable is provided at the rear end of the screw rod, a sliding block is threadedly connected to the screw rod, the right guide plate is slidably connected to the sliding block, a front-back symmetrical connecting block is provided at the right end of the top of the base, and water pipes are provided on the connecting blocks.
[0007] As an improvement to the above scheme, the lifting device includes a fixed plate, a sliding plate, a fixed block and an electric push rod. A fixed plate is provided in the middle of the top of the base, an electric push rod is provided on the left side of the fixed plate, a sliding plate is provided inside the fixed plate, a fixed block is provided on the left side of the sliding plate, the sliding plate is connected to the bottom of the connecting frame, and the push rod of the electric push rod is connected to the fixed block.
[0008] As an improvement to the above solution, a placement frame is further included, and a placement frame is slidably provided on the inner side of the left end of the connecting frame.
[0009] As an improvement to the above solution, it also includes a fixing frame and a nozzle. The fixing frame is provided on the right side of the connecting frame, and the nozzle is provided at the other end of the water pipe, and the nozzle is hung on the fixing frame.
[0010] As an improvement to the above solution, a short drainage pipe is further included. The short drainage pipe is provided on the right side of the bottom of the connecting frame.
[0011] As an improvement to the above solution, a soft pillow is further included. A soft pillow is provided on the top of the sliding block.
[0012] The utility model adjusts the nursing bracket to the same height as the patient's bed surface by means of an electric push rod lifting and lowering connection frame, and can adjust the position of the sliding block by means of a screw mechanism, so that the patient is more comfortable when being moved or receiving care.
[0013] The utility model can clean the wound and replace the medicine for the patient in a timely and effective manner, which helps to maintain good personal hygiene, promote wound healing and reduce the risk of infection.
[0014] The design of the utility model takes into account the simplicity of operation. For example, it can be directly connected to an external water pump to clean the patient's head, and medicines and medical supplies can be easily stored and retrieved, which greatly improves work efficiency. [0022] A brain care bracket, such as Figure 1 and Figure 2As shown, it includes a base 2, a sliding block 6, a connecting frame 4, a guide plate 5, a wheel 7, a screw rod 10, a turntable 11, a water pipe 14 and a connecting block 15. The base 2 is provided with four wheels 7, each wheel 7 is provided with a brake for fixing the entire nursing bracket during brain nursing operations. A lifting device is provided in the middle of the top of the base 2, and a connecting frame 4 is provided on the top of the lifting device. A left-right symmetrical guide plate 5 is provided in the middle of the connecting frame 4. The two guide plates 5 are connected to the front and back sides of the connecting frame 4. A screw rod 10 is rotatably provided on the left guide plate 5. The rear end of the screw rod 10 rotatably passes through the guide plate 5 and the connecting frame 4. A turntable 11 is provided at the rear end of the screw rod 10. A grip is provided on the turntable 11 for convenience of medical staff in rotating the turntable 11. The sliding block 6 is threadedly connected to the screw rod 10. The right guide plate 5 is slidably connected to the sliding block 6. A front-back symmetrical connecting block 15 is provided at the right end of the top of the base 2, and a water pipe 14 is provided on the connecting block 15.
[0023] like Figure 5 As shown, the lifting device includes a fixed plate 1, a sliding plate 3, a fixed block 31 and an electric push rod 8. A fixed plate 1 is provided in the middle of the top of the base 2, an electric push rod 8 is provided on the left side of the fixed plate 1, a sliding plate 3 is slidingly provided inside the fixed plate 1, a fixed block 31 is provided on the left side of the sliding plate 3, the sliding plate 3 is connected to the bottom of the connecting frame 4, and the push rod of the electric push rod 8 is connected to the fixed block 31.
[0024] like Figure 1 As shown, it also includes a placement frame 9. The placement frame 9 is slidably provided on the inner side of the left end of the connecting frame 4. The placement frame 9 can be used to place medicines and medical instruments.
[0025] like Figure 2 As shown, it also includes a fixing frame 12 and a nozzle 13. The fixing frame 12 is provided on the right side of the connecting frame 4, and the nozzle 13 is provided at the other end of the water pipe 14. The nozzle 13 is hung on the fixing frame 12. The two nozzles 13 can spray clean water and disinfectant such as saline solution respectively, which is beneficial to improve the cleaning efficiency.
[0026] like Figure 2 As shown, a short drainage pipe 41 is also included. The short drainage pipe 41 is provided on the right side of the bottom of the connecting frame 4. A lid is provided on the other end of the short drainage pipe 41. After cleaning, a sewage bucket is taken out and placed directly under the short drainage pipe 41. The lid is opened to discharge the waste liquid cleaned in the connecting frame 4.
[0027] like Figure 3 As shown, a soft pillow 61 is also included. A soft pillow 61 is provided on the top of the sliding block 6, and the soft pillow 61 can further increase the comfort of the patient.
[0028] The medical staff moves the nursing bracket to the patient's bed and then starts the electric push rod 8. The electric push rod 8 pushes the sliding plate 3 up and down to raise and lower the connecting frame 4, aligns the height of the connecting frame 4 with the patient's bed, and carefully moves the patient to the nursing bracket. The turntable 11 is twisted, and the turntable 11 drives the screw rod 10 to rotate. The screw rod 10 moves the sliding block 6 back and forth on the guide plate 5. When the sliding block 6 slides to a position where the patient's head can lie comfortably, pick up the nozzle 13, connect the water pump to the lower end of the water pipe 14, turn on the water pump, and gently wash the patient's head with clean water or saline. After washing, turn off the external water pump, and change the dressing and bandage the patient's head.
